Understanding Sexual Hygiene
Sexual care involves taking care of yourself, your genitals, and hygiene in order to promote health and prevent infection. This includes taking a regular shower, washing your hands before and after sexual activity, and maintaining a clean environment. Understanding the importance of good sexual hygiene will help you make better decisions for yourself and your partner.
Sexual hygiene is important
For many reasons, sexual hygiene is essential. It helps to prevent the spread of sexually transmitted diseases (STIs). By cleaning the genital region and using safe sex, you can reduce your risk of contracting the disease or spreading it. Sexual hygiene can also improve your confidence, comfort, and health. This will allow you to have a more enjoyable time during intercourse.

Cleaning
Follow these practices to be clean when you are sexing:
Wash before: Hands, genital region, and mild soap should be washed before sexual activity. This will help to eliminate bacteria and reduce infection risk. Rest again afterward to avoid discomfort and be clean.
Urine After Intercourse: Urine is a good way to eliminate bacteria from the urine. This simple technique can reduce the risk of urinary tract infections (UTIs) in both men and women.
Use condoms: They not only prevent pregnancy and sexually transmissible infections, but they also keep you clean during sex. They work as a barrier, preventing direct contact while minimizing changes in the body.

Sexual Transmission Prevention And Control
Sexual health is a vital part of prevention and control.
These Are The Key Points:
Safe sex Using condoms and brushing your teeth can help reduce the risk that you will contract the virus. It is important to have regular testing and communicate with your sexual partners.
Vaccination can prevent certain diseases, such as HPV and Hepatitis B.
Schedule regular STI testing with your doctor. This is especially important if you have sex with a partner who is new to you or if there are multiple partners. Early diagnosis and treatment is the key to managing STIs effectively.
